- Sleep Deprivation. Studies show that Americans work longer and harder
than workers anywhere else. There have been many fatigue related catastrophes including the Exxon
Valdez oil spill of 1989 and the Three Mile Island nuclear accident of 1979. However, despite
the danger to the public, no standards existed for the safe limits of fatigue on the job. William
Bailey's representation of Dave Truitt became the leading national case on sleep deprivation. In
September, 1991, Mr. Truitt was ordered to work 36 straight hours on a paper mill repair job in
southern Washington. On his way home, he fell asleep at the wheel and veered off the road, suffering
severe brain injuries. The case was featured in USA Today, The Detroit News and a number
of other national publications. Right-wing radio personality, Rush Limbaugh, specifically criticized
Bailey on his show for bringing the suit, which Bailey regards as an honor.
